smg_comms_c_wrappers 30 /****************
smg_comms_c_wrappers 31 * Add the unsigned integer V to the mpi-integer U and store the
smg_comms_c_wrappers 32 * result in W. U and V may be the same.
smg_comms_c_wrappers 33 */
smg_comms_c_wrappers 34 void
smg_comms_c_wrappers 35 mpi_add_ui(MPI w, MPI u, unsigned long v )
smg_comms_c_wrappers 36 {
smg_comms_c_wrappers 37 mpi_ptr_t wp, up;
smg_comms_c_wrappers 38 mpi_size_t usize, wsize;
smg_comms_c_wrappers 39 int usign, wsign;
smg_comms_c_wrappers 40
smg_comms_c_wrappers 41 usize = u->nlimbs;
smg_comms_c_wrappers 42 usign = u->sign;
smg_comms_c_wrappers 43 wsign = 0;
smg_comms_c_wrappers 44
smg_comms_c_wrappers 45 /* If not space for W (and possible carry), increase space. */
smg_comms_c_wrappers 46 wsize = usize + 1;
smg_comms_c_wrappers 47 if( w->alloced < wsize )
smg_comms_c_wrappers 48 mpi_resize(w, wsize);
smg_comms_c_wrappers 49
smg_comms_c_wrappers 50 /* These must be after realloc (U may be the same as W). */
smg_comms_c_wrappers 51 up = u->d;
smg_comms_c_wrappers 52 wp = w->d;
smg_comms_c_wrappers 53
smg_comms_c_wrappers 54 if( !usize ) { /* simple */
smg_comms_c_wrappers 55 wp[0] = v;
smg_comms_c_wrappers 56 wsize = v? 1:0;
smg_comms_c_wrappers 57 }
smg_comms_c_wrappers 58 else if( !usign ) { /* mpi is not negative */
smg_comms_c_wrappers 59 mpi_limb_t cy;
smg_comms_c_wrappers 60 cy = mpihelp_add_1(wp, up, usize, v);
smg_comms_c_wrappers 61 wp[usize] = cy;
smg_comms_c_wrappers 62 wsize = usize + cy;
smg_comms_c_wrappers 63 }
smg_comms_c_wrappers 64 else { /* The signs are different. Need exact comparison to determine
smg_comms_c_wrappers 65 * which operand to subtract from which. */
smg_comms_c_wrappers 66 if( usize == 1 && up[0] < v ) {
smg_comms_c_wrappers 67 wp[0] = v - up[0];
smg_comms_c_wrappers 68 wsize = 1;
smg_comms_c_wrappers 69 }
smg_comms_c_wrappers 70 else {
smg_comms_c_wrappers 71 mpihelp_sub_1(wp, up, usize, v);
smg_comms_c_wrappers 72 /* Size can decrease with at most one limb. */
smg_comms_c_wrappers 73 wsize = usize - (wp[usize-1]==0);
smg_comms_c_wrappers 74 wsign = 1;
smg_comms_c_wrappers 75 }
smg_comms_c_wrappers 76 }
smg_comms_c_wrappers 77
smg_comms_c_wrappers 78 w->nlimbs = wsize;
smg_comms_c_wrappers 79 w->sign = wsign;
smg_comms_c_wrappers 80 }
smg_comms_c_wrappers 81
smg_comms_c_wrappers 82
smg_comms_c_wrappers 83 void
smg_comms_c_wrappers 84 mpi_add(MPI w, MPI u, MPI v)
smg_comms_c_wrappers 85 {
smg_comms_c_wrappers 86 mpi_ptr_t wp, up, vp;
smg_comms_c_wrappers 87 mpi_size_t usize, vsize, wsize;
smg_comms_c_wrappers 88 int usign, vsign, wsign;
smg_comms_c_wrappers 89
smg_comms_c_wrappers 90 if( u->nlimbs < v->nlimbs ) { /* Swap U and V. */
smg_comms_c_wrappers 91 usize = v->nlimbs;
smg_comms_c_wrappers 92 usign = v->sign;
smg_comms_c_wrappers 93 vsize = u->nlimbs;
smg_comms_c_wrappers 94 vsign = u->sign;
smg_comms_c_wrappers 95 wsize = usize + 1;
smg_comms_c_wrappers 96 RESIZE_IF_NEEDED(w, wsize);
smg_comms_c_wrappers 97 /* These must be after realloc (u or v may be the same as w). */
smg_comms_c_wrappers 98 up = v->d;
smg_comms_c_wrappers 99 vp = u->d;
smg_comms_c_wrappers 100 }
smg_comms_c_wrappers 101 else {
smg_comms_c_wrappers 102 usize = u->nlimbs;
smg_comms_c_wrappers 103 usign = u->sign;
smg_comms_c_wrappers 104 vsize = v->nlimbs;
smg_comms_c_wrappers 105 vsign = v->sign;
smg_comms_c_wrappers 106 wsize = usize + 1;
smg_comms_c_wrappers 107 RESIZE_IF_NEEDED(w, wsize);
smg_comms_c_wrappers 108 /* These must be after realloc (u or v may be the same as w). */
smg_comms_c_wrappers 109 up = u->d;
smg_comms_c_wrappers 110 vp = v->d;
smg_comms_c_wrappers 111 }
smg_comms_c_wrappers 112 wp = w->d;
smg_comms_c_wrappers 113 wsign = 0;
smg_comms_c_wrappers 114
smg_comms_c_wrappers 115 if( !vsize ) { /* simple */
smg_comms_c_wrappers 116 MPN_COPY(wp, up, usize );
smg_comms_c_wrappers 117 wsize = usize;
smg_comms_c_wrappers 118 wsign = usign;
smg_comms_c_wrappers 119 }
smg_comms_c_wrappers 120 else if( usign != vsign ) { /* different sign */
smg_comms_c_wrappers 121 /* This test is right since USIZE >= VSIZE */
smg_comms_c_wrappers 122 if( usize != vsize ) {
smg_comms_c_wrappers 123 mpihelp_sub(wp, up, usize, vp, vsize);
smg_comms_c_wrappers 124 wsize = usize;
smg_comms_c_wrappers 125 MPN_NORMALIZE(wp, wsize);
smg_comms_c_wrappers 126 wsign = usign;
smg_comms_c_wrappers 127 }
smg_comms_c_wrappers 128 else if( mpihelp_cmp(up, vp, usize) < 0 ) {
smg_comms_c_wrappers 129 mpihelp_sub_n(wp, vp, up, usize);
smg_comms_c_wrappers 130 wsize = usize;
smg_comms_c_wrappers 131 MPN_NORMALIZE(wp, wsize);
smg_comms_c_wrappers 132 if( !usign )
smg_comms_c_wrappers 133 wsign = 1;
smg_comms_c_wrappers 134 }
smg_comms_c_wrappers 135 else {
smg_comms_c_wrappers 136 mpihelp_sub_n(wp, up, vp, usize);
smg_comms_c_wrappers 137 wsize = usize;
smg_comms_c_wrappers 138 MPN_NORMALIZE(wp, wsize);
smg_comms_c_wrappers 139 if( usign )
smg_comms_c_wrappers 140 wsign = 1;
smg_comms_c_wrappers 141 }
smg_comms_c_wrappers 142 }
smg_comms_c_wrappers 143 else { /* U and V have same sign. Add them. */
smg_comms_c_wrappers 144 mpi_limb_t cy = mpihelp_add(wp, up, usize, vp, vsize);
smg_comms_c_wrappers 145 wp[usize] = cy;
smg_comms_c_wrappers 146 wsize = usize + cy;
smg_comms_c_wrappers 147 if( usign )
smg_comms_c_wrappers 148 wsign = 1;
smg_comms_c_wrappers 149 }
smg_comms_c_wrappers 150
smg_comms_c_wrappers 151 w->nlimbs = wsize;
smg_comms_c_wrappers 152 w->sign = wsign;
smg_comms_c_wrappers 153 }

smg_comms_c_wrappers 156 /****************
smg_comms_c_wrappers 157 * Subtract the unsigned integer V from the mpi-integer U and store the
smg_comms_c_wrappers 158 * result in W.
smg_comms_c_wrappers 159 */
smg_comms_c_wrappers 160 void
smg_comms_c_wrappers 161 mpi_sub_ui(MPI w, MPI u, unsigned long v )
smg_comms_c_wrappers 162 {
smg_comms_c_wrappers 163 mpi_ptr_t wp, up;
smg_comms_c_wrappers 164 mpi_size_t usize, wsize;
smg_comms_c_wrappers 165 int usign, wsign;
smg_comms_c_wrappers 166
smg_comms_c_wrappers 167 usize = u->nlimbs;
smg_comms_c_wrappers 168 usign = u->sign;
smg_comms_c_wrappers 169 wsign = 0;
smg_comms_c_wrappers 170
smg_comms_c_wrappers 171 /* If not space for W (and possible carry), increase space. */
smg_comms_c_wrappers 172 wsize = usize + 1;
smg_comms_c_wrappers 173 if( w->alloced < wsize )
smg_comms_c_wrappers 174 mpi_resize(w, wsize);
smg_comms_c_wrappers 175
smg_comms_c_wrappers 176 /* These must be after realloc (U may be the same as W). */
smg_comms_c_wrappers 177 up = u->d;
smg_comms_c_wrappers 178 wp = w->d;
smg_comms_c_wrappers 179
smg_comms_c_wrappers 180 if( !usize ) { /* simple */
smg_comms_c_wrappers 181 wp[0] = v;
smg_comms_c_wrappers 182 wsize = v? 1:0;
smg_comms_c_wrappers 183 wsign = 1;
smg_comms_c_wrappers 184 }
smg_comms_c_wrappers 185 else if( usign ) { /* mpi and v are negative */
smg_comms_c_wrappers 186 mpi_limb_t cy;
smg_comms_c_wrappers 187 cy = mpihelp_add_1(wp, up, usize, v);
smg_comms_c_wrappers 188 wp[usize] = cy;
smg_comms_c_wrappers 189 wsize = usize + cy;
smg_comms_c_wrappers 190 }
smg_comms_c_wrappers 191 else { /* The signs are different. Need exact comparison to determine
smg_comms_c_wrappers 192 * which operand to subtract from which. */
smg_comms_c_wrappers 193 if( usize == 1 && up[0] < v ) {
smg_comms_c_wrappers 194 wp[0] = v - up[0];
smg_comms_c_wrappers 195 wsize = 1;
smg_comms_c_wrappers 196 wsign = 1;
smg_comms_c_wrappers 197 }
smg_comms_c_wrappers 198 else {
smg_comms_c_wrappers 199 mpihelp_sub_1(wp, up, usize, v);
smg_comms_c_wrappers 200 /* Size can decrease with at most one limb. */
smg_comms_c_wrappers 201 wsize = usize - (wp[usize-1]==0);
smg_comms_c_wrappers 202 }
smg_comms_c_wrappers 203 }
smg_comms_c_wrappers 204
smg_comms_c_wrappers 205 w->nlimbs = wsize;
smg_comms_c_wrappers 206 w->sign = wsign;
smg_comms_c_wrappers 207 }
smg_comms_c_wrappers 208
smg_comms_c_wrappers 209 void
smg_comms_c_wrappers 210 mpi_sub(MPI w, MPI u, MPI v)
smg_comms_c_wrappers 211 {
smg_comms_c_wrappers 212 if( w == v ) {
smg_comms_c_wrappers 213 MPI vv = mpi_copy(v);
smg_comms_c_wrappers 214 vv->sign = !vv->sign;
smg_comms_c_wrappers 215 mpi_add( w, u, vv );
smg_comms_c_wrappers 216 mpi_free(vv);
smg_comms_c_wrappers 217 }
smg_comms_c_wrappers 218 else {
smg_comms_c_wrappers 219 /* fixme: this is not thread-save (we temp. modify v) */
smg_comms_c_wrappers 220 v->sign = !v->sign;
smg_comms_c_wrappers 221 mpi_add( w, u, v );
smg_comms_c_wrappers 222 v->sign = !v->sign;
smg_comms_c_wrappers 223 }
smg_comms_c_wrappers 224 }
smg_comms_c_wrappers 225
smg_comms_c_wrappers 226
smg_comms_c_wrappers 227 void
smg_comms_c_wrappers 228 mpi_addm( MPI w, MPI u, MPI v, MPI m)
smg_comms_c_wrappers 229 {
smg_comms_c_wrappers 230 mpi_add(w, u, v);
smg_comms_c_wrappers 231 mpi_fdiv_r( w, w, m );
smg_comms_c_wrappers 232 }
smg_comms_c_wrappers 233
smg_comms_c_wrappers 234 void
smg_comms_c_wrappers 235 mpi_subm( MPI w, MPI u, MPI v, MPI m)
smg_comms_c_wrappers 236 {
smg_comms_c_wrappers 237 mpi_sub(w, u, v);
smg_comms_c_wrappers 238 mpi_fdiv_r( w, w, m );
smg_comms_c_wrappers 239 }
